The size of Thirroul is approximately 4.9 square kilometres. There are 20 parks, covering nearly 52.5% of the total area. The population of Thirroul in 2016 was 6083 people. By 2021 the population was 6348 showing a population growth of 4.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Thirroul is 40-49 years. Households in Thirroul are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Thirroul work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 77.50% of the homes in Thirroul were owner-occupied compared with 77.20% in 2016.
